OUR COMPANY

  • LoneStar is a leading global provider of standardized and custom highperformance fasteners, gaskets, and flowcontrol components to the oil and gas and the power generation industries. Headquartered in the UK, the group consists of 13 business units across North America, Europe, the Middle East and Asia Pacific.**
  • We are seeking a skilled Business Analyst who will leverage analytical tools to drive improvements in pricing, forecasting, sales opportunity conversion, and inventory health. This role involves identifying and prioritizing opportunities to leverage LoneStar's data for driving business solutions. Responsibilities include collecting and preparing data from various sources, maintaining databases, and collaborating with different functional teams to implement models and automation.
  • The Business Analyst will analyze data to uncover patterns and trends, develop hypotheses, and create custom data models and algorithms. Additionally, they will build predictive forecasting models and ensure their accuracy through monitoring. Communication of findings and actionable insights to stakeholders is a key aspect of this role.
  • Furthermore, the role supports production planning by analyzing product demand and establishing service level targets to meet sales and inventory objectives. This position is pivotal in identifying and prioritizing opportunities to leverage LoneStar's data for practical business solutions and providing strategic pricing guidance to LoneStar Americas' sales teams.
